Winners of Bangabandhu, SAG gold to get Rs 5 lakh for each

KATHMANDU: The All Nepal Football Association on Wednesday announced that it would award members of the winning teams of the Bangabandhu Gold Cup and the South Asian Games men's football with Rs 500,000 each.

As both teams had almost same members, a player included in both squads would get Rs 1 million.

An executive committee meeting of the football governing body on Wednesday made the decision to this effect.

The committee headed by acting President Narendra Shrestha also decided to honour members of the female squad who won the silver in the SAG with Rs 100,000 each.

Coaches of the respective teams will also be honoured with the equal prize money in a function to be held next month.

Other decisions of the meeting include organising a U-16 Championship annually in memory of its acting President Lalit Krishna from this year and including the championship in the ANFA calendar, launching a pilot project in the Mid-western and Far-western regions by technically and financially helping the District Football Associations and clubs to gradually increase footballing activities, and starting the process of club licensing for A Division Clubs and potential B Division Clubs from this year.

The meeting also approved its annual calendar.
